Gabriel Antonio Ortiz Tello (born 8 December 1981) is a Mexican race walker who specializes in 20km (10miles) races.
He competed at the 2004 and 2006 World Race Walking Cups, and finished fourth at the Central American and Caribbean Games.[1] He also competed at the 2007 World Championships, but was disqualified there.
